Deutsche Bank

Quarterly Financials

Values in thousands 2024-06-30 2024-03-31 2023-12-31 2023-09-30
Revenue
$17,227,000
$17,255,000
$6,170,000
$6,886,000
Gross Profit
16,203,000
16,059,000
6,170,000
7,009,000
EBITDA
-573,000
-169,000
1,112,000
-24,000
EBIT
-208,000
1,866,000
2,500,000
1,698,000
Net Income
-143,000
1,422,000
1,399,000
1,176,000
Net Change In Cash
17,227,000
17,255,000
6,170,000
6,886,000
Cash
155,958,000
156,341,000
184,556,000
175,887,000
Basic Shares
1,998,000
2,058,300
2,093,151
2,107,800

Annual Financials

Values in thousands 2023-12-31 2022-12-31 2021-12-31 2020-12-31
Revenue
$27,376,000
$26,656,000
$25,303,000
$23,891,000
Gross Profit
27,376,000
26,656,000
25,303,000
23,891,000
EBITDA
-1,071,000
16,110,000
3,245,000
874,000
EBIT
-3,013,000
14,168,000
3,245,000
874,000
Net Income
4,772,000
5,525,000
2,365,000
483,000
Net Change In Cash
27,376,000
26,656,000
25,303,000
23,891,000
Free Cash Flow
5,184,000
-2,450,000
-3,502,000
30,224,000
Cash
184,556,000
186,091,000
199,363,000
175,338,000
Basic Shares
2,104,000
2,125,600
2,143,199
2,170,100

Earnings Calls

Quarter EPS
2024-06-30
$0.76
2024-03-31
$0.49
2023-12-31
$0.69
2023-09-30
$0.51